Transaction 3062a7636db43c23eed042d5a3a4a8321e4159e8a269347048e944da62f3ec29
1 Input
1 Output
-
3062a7636db43c23eed042d5a3a4a8321e4159e8a269347048e944da62f3ec29:0
- value
- 154399
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4138bb2d6dda9c56fde4ca8f2b0a225f51b05878 OP_EQUAL
- address
- 37dsomCsZewmgURuAVA5aeEnuiPL2qv9cd